From the Publisher

For the first time in Canadian media history, buyers of Garth Turner's new 2001 Retirement Guide will receive a live seminar presentation along with a practical and useful printed guide to top financial strategies. The seminar is contained in an original 45-minute video program on CD, produced by Turner exclusively for the Retirement Guide, and complements the 128-page book. It is the most complete audio, video and print project of its kind ever produced.

On the CD, which can be played on most computers now on the market, viewers get a chance to experience the live seminar presentation which has made Garth Turner the most popular and effective public speaker in Canada. Turner presents his top five RRSP strategies for 2001, highlighting such topics as making retirement contributions without cash, and how to put the mortgage on your home inside your own RRSP.

About the Author

GARTH TURNER ''s bestselling books include 2020: New Rules for the New Age, 2015: After the Boom: The Strategy: A Homeowner''s Guide to Wealth Creation, The Defense: Guarding Your Money in Uncertain Times, and the annual Garth Turner''s RRSP Guide . Turner is host of Investment Television and is a nationally--syndicated radio and TV broadcaster and newspaper columnist. He is CEO of Millennium Media Television-Canada''s leading independent producer of programming for major networks--and a popular public speaker.
